Dr Feelgood guitarist Wilko Johnson diagnosed with terminal cancer

Wilko Johnson, who served a high-profile stint as a guitarist with British punk outfit Dr Feelgood, has been diagnosed with terminal cancer of the pancreas.

A statement issued by Johnson’s manager Robert Hoy confirmed that Johnson has chosen not to receive chemotherapy.
